We’re looking for an enthusiastic 1st Line Support Technician to join a growing team in Nantwich. This is a great opportunity for someone with excellent customer service skills and a genuine passion for technology.
You’ll mainly provide software support to users, helping troubleshoot issues, log tickets, guide customers through fixes, and escalate more complex queries when needed. Full professional tech experience isn’t essential; we’re more interested in someone who communicates well, enjoys problem-solving, and is keen to build a career in IT.
We’re looking for someone with:
- Excellent customer service or customer-facing experience
- A genuine interest in IT, software, and technology
- Strong communication and problem-solving skills
- A patient, helpful, and professional approach
- Confidence learning new systems and explaining solutions clearly
- A positive attitude and willingness to learn
- Previous IT support experience is helpful but not essential

How to prepare for a job interview at Exalto Consulting
✨Show Your Enthusiasm
Make sure to express your genuine passion for technology during the interview. Share examples of how you've engaged with tech in your personal life or previous roles,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.
✨Demonstrate Customer Service Skills
Prepare to discuss your customer service experience. Think of specific situations where you helped someone solve a problem or provided excellent support. This will highlight your ability to communicate effectively and handle queries professionally.
✨Problem-Solving Scenarios
Be ready to tackle some hypothetical troubleshooting scenarios. Practice explaining your thought process clearly, as this will showcase your problem-solving skills and confidence in guiding customers through fixes.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ions about the team and the technologies they use. This shows your interest in the role and helps you understand if it’s the right fit for you.
